• Radio Mode: Switch between Network mode and PHY Diagnostics. If the value equals 0, it is in
Network mode; if the value equals 1, it is in PHY Diagnostics. PHY Diagnostics mode is only relevant
for users who wish to run diagnostic tests on the radio.
• Apply: Applies the new values but does not save them to flash.
• Save and Apply: Save the new values to flash and apply.
